Cold Room Insulation: Improving Energy Reduction

Proper shielding for refrigerated spaces is critical to reaching significant energy efficiency. A poorly insulated room experiences greater heat transfer, forcing the chiller to work harder and consume more power. Choosing the appropriate insulation type – such as spray foam – and ensuring adequate installation are necessary steps in lowering operational outlays and reducing your ecological footprint. Regular examination of the current insulation can also reveal potential weaknesses and enable early repairs.
